09:41 — First sign of trouble: the chip reader at the Orlin Valley Marathon's 10k mat stopped logging splits. Turned out a firmware update overnight reset the antenna gain, so chips were only read at walking pace. Teo rolled the firmware back on-site. The rollback build is noted below.

build token for kagaf-hahof: htk14_9d3d4d26d7d8de

## Releases

PickPath Optimizer ships monthly. Tag from `main`, run the full route-simulation suite, and confirm zone-balancing benchmarks stay within 2% of baseline. Artifacts build via the Larkspur CI pipeline; no manual uploads. Changelog entries are mandatory for any heuristic change. Every release tarball must be verified before promotion to the Dunmore warehouse fleet. Verify signatures against the key below.

deploy key for kajof-fajop: bky6_gDHw9Q

Subject: DR drill notes — SnackRoute planner

Hey future maintainers,

Quick heads-up from today's disaster-recovery drill for SnackRoute, our vending-machine restock planner. We killed the primary scheduler on purpose and the route optimizer limped along fine, though the restock forecasts went stale after about an hour. Restore steps are in the runbook, nothing fancy. One gotcha: the backup archive is encrypted, so when prompted during restore, use the recovery passphrase below.

unlock words, kagef-taduf: fenir-quenix-norwyn-sorvan-gormir-gorir-fraok